Hello Richard, :)
It has been more than a year that I did not use my S1 (I had sold my ps4 pro) and wanted to change to next gen console. In this month I could take a Xbox series X so now I use it again. It works perfectly with those new features and updates that you initiated in the meantime.
I'm a bit confused about some options which did not have apart in the previous version I used to use and I might have misunderstood the guidance.
For example as I see there is hotkey option in the HIP scenario however it is empty as default. In older versions there was no hotkey for HIP.
So ..If I choose Battlefield 1 and I set a hotkey for the game for example F1 then should I set F1 to the HIP scenario as hotkey or do I leave it empty ?
I tried both ways when I set F1 to HIP which sensitivity is 2.0 it works well movements are predictible but If I delete the hotkey F1 from HIP scenario then movements becomes much more sensitive on the same rate (HIP 2.0). It is like I would increase the sensitivity. I tested it with my Logitec G403 that I set 7000 DPI with 500 hz refresh rate however the effect is the same independent of the DPI settings.
I am not saying that it is an issue I just would like to know how to use it properly.
The other feature I was surprised by is in the curve settings if I remember well the 'smoothness'. What it is used for or rather when is it worth applying it ?
Thank you in advance
-
1. HIP sub-profile will be activated automatically, when a config is activated by a hotkey,
there is no need to set a hotkey for HIP for most of the situations, just leave it empty.
2. unless you are using TBD1~3 and set their modes to toggle, sometimes, users will forget which sub-profile they are using,
then you will need a hotkey for HIP, to bring you back to normal.
3. as for the smoothness, it's worthy to try 1~8, it will more smoothness to your mouse movements,
but if it's set to a big one, you will feel some delay.
